| Collections in Context provides expert advice and qualified appraisals for private collectors, cultural organizations, and museums. Based in the Washington D.C. and the Boston metro areas, Collections in Context offers collectors accredited, qualified written appraisals that conform to the recent IRS guidelines for non-cash charitable donations. We also write qualified appraisals for estate tax purposes or for insurance replacement values. Each year, during selected winter months, Collections in Context offers its services to clients in the Miami area. A full-service art consultation firm, we advise clients on the on-going care, display, and transporting of their collections. We also supervise a collection's storage and display requirements. We'll assist you in obtaining the correct preservation or conservation treatments for your art works. In trying to anticipate the needs of our clients, we are glad to conduct extensive research for publications, for personal catalogues, or for provenance history. We will help you with all aspects of your collections. We specialize in: Modern and contemporary art The art of Israeli and Jewish artists Judaica artifacts and books Antiquities
For clients wishing who do desire a formal appraisal and who wish simply to get an estimate of the current value of their art works, we offer, for a fee, a "Professional Opinion of Value." The POV, written according to appraisal standards, simply states a current fair market value of your object or art work.
